2 Cor 10:18 "Not What I Commend but what God Commends" (September 17)

God is always doing us good...even when He sends us people who make us feel worthless.  Wonder why I would think that they make me feel that way when it's actually my lofty strongholds gone awry and I need that approval.  There are a couple of thoughts for me straight from God's heart in these verses:

2 Cor 10:4  ~ We  have Divine Power to destroy strongholds.  Can I even grasp that thought?  For this moment, this place, this circumstance---anything that trips me up and makes me want to live falsely.

2 Cor 10:18 ~ "It is not the one who commends himself who is approved, but the one whom the Lord commends."  What matters most is that it is the LORD Himself commending me.  This goes beyond all reason.
